What are the responsibilities and job description for the Assistant Supervisor, Gardener position at Architect of the Capitol?
Duties
Summary
This position is located at the Architect of the Capitol (AOC); Capitol Grounds and Arboretum; Gardening Division. The Gardener Assistant Supervisor assists with maintaining the overall efficiency and effectiveness of maintenance of the grounds. This includes the lawns, landscape beds, hardscape and all adjoining parks of the U.S. Capitol Building, House and Senate Office Buildings, Page schools and Childcare centers, Union Square and Staff parking lots.
Requirements
Qualifications
You must meet all eligibility and qualification requirements by the closing date of the job announcement. Applicants must meet the following requirements: -Have ability to supervise employees in the performance of gardening work. (Screen-out) -Possess a valid, unexpired driver's license at the time of application. -Apply to become a pesticide "Registered Technician" in the District of Columbia within 30 days of the effective date of employment. IMPORTANT NOTE: If the required licenses or registration are not obtained within the time periods specified, the incumbent will be terminated for failure to meet the conditions of continued employment.
The mission of the Architect of the Capitol (AOC) is to serve Congress and the Supreme Court, preserve America's Capitol and inspire memorable experiences. The AOC is responsible for the maintenance, operation, development and preservation of 18.4 million square feet of buildings and more than 570 acres of land throughout Capitol Hill. The AOC provides a welcoming and educational environment for millions of visitors through the U.S. Capitol Visitor Center and the US Botanic Garden.
